A meeting between Armenian and Spanish Prime Ministers Nikol Pashinyan and Pedro Sánchez took place within the framework of the European Political Community Summit in Yerevan.
The interlocutors discussed the prospects for developing bilateral relations, emphasizing the importance of activating political dialogue and expanding economic cooperation. The parties also touched upon the ongoing processes within the framework of the Armenia-European Union partnership and regional issues of mutual interest.
Prime Minister Pashinyan presented the process of reforms implemented by the Government of Armenia, emphasizing the steps taken to strengthen democracy, the rule of law and economic development.
The interlocutors considered cooperation in the economic, energy and tourism sectors to be promising.
During the meeting, the parties also emphasized the importance of efforts aimed at ensuring regional stability and peace, as well as maintaining continuous dialogue on international platforms.
